Albanians Targeted in UK Immigration Debate
Albania’s ambassador to the UK says media reports unfairly blame Albanians for illegal immigration. He claims this is part of a biased narrative. The ambassador criticizes right-wing media and the Home Secretary.
Uran Ferizi, the Albanian ambassador, wrote to the Guardian to express his concerns. He believes right-wing media and politicians are targeting Albanians in the UK. The Home Secretary, Shabana Mahmood, has also discussed the issue of immigration. The ambassador says statistics are being manipulated. This is causing unfair blame to fall on Albanian people in schools and workplaces.
